Explore key concepts in quantum physics through this 10-minute lecture on energy quantization from the Matter and Interactions series. Delve into the spectrum of light, examine the Bohr model of the atom, and understand the significance of Planck's constant. Access accompanying demo programs on GlowScript to enhance your understanding of these fundamental principles. Part of a comprehensive playlist covering various topics in physics, this lecture provides essential insights into the quantized nature of energy and its implications for atomic structure and light emission.
